toRST
Convert various data formats to reStructuredText tables.
Currently supports:
- CSV
- JSON
Planned formats:
- Excel
installation
pip install toRST
CLI Usage
example
Convert file1.csv and file2.json into RST
torst file1.csv file2.json -o ./outputfolder
Positional Arguments:
inputs One or more input files to convert to RST. Currently only CSV and JSON files are supported, but additional formats will be added.
Optional Arguments:
-o, --output_dir Output directory for generated RST files. Defaults to the current working directory if not provided.
Python Usage
example
Import Table class
from toRST.toRST import Table
Convert file1.csv into RST string
rst_table = Table('file1.csv').build_table()
Can also convert list[list or tuple or dict]
into RST by passing the object into the Table
class
